TRIAMCINOLONE (try-am-SIN-oh-lone uh-SET-oh-nide) ACETONIDE - NASAL
COMMON BRAND NAME(S):
Nasacort
USES: Nasacort AQ is a nasal steroid that works directly on nasal tissue to reduce swelling and inflammation.
Nasacort AQ is used to treat nasal itching, runny nose, postnasal drip, nasal congestion and sneezing
associated with allergic rhinitis.
HOW TO USE:
To get the most benefit from Nasacort AQ, make sure you understand how to use the nasal spray properly.
Ask your doctor or pharmacist to demonstrate the correct way to use a nasal spray. Shake well before using Nasacort AQ. Nasacort AQ must reach the nasal tissue to be effective. Therefore, blow your nose to clear the nasal
passage before using Nasacort AQ. If passages are blocked, a nasal decongestant may be used first
(for a maximum of 3 to 5 days) to open the passages allowing proper penetration of the medication.
Be sure to aim spray away from the middle of the nose, that is, away from the nasal septum and toward the
inflamed areas inside the nasal passages. Use Nasacort AQ exactly as prescribed. It must be used routinely
to be effective. Do not increase your dose or use Nasacort AQ more frequently than directed without your doctor's approval.
It may take a few days before the benefits of Nasacort AQ are noticed. If after 2 to 3 weeks no improvement in symptoms
is noticed, consult your doctor. Use Nasacort AQ with caution if sores or injuries are present in the nasal passages.
SIDE EFFECTS:
Nasacort AQ may cause irritation, stinging,
burning, or dryness of the nasal passages. Sneezing, nosebleed, headache,
lightheadedness, loss of taste, throat irritation or nausea may also
occur. If these effects continue or become bothersome, inform your doctor.
Unlikely but report promptly: persistent nose or throat
irritation/soreness, white patchy areas. Very unlikely but report
promptly: broken or damaged nasal membranes, unusual weakness, weight
loss, nausea/vomiting, fainting, dizziness, vision changes. If you notice
other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ist.
PRECAUTIONS: Nasacort AQ should be used with caution if the following medical conditions exist: glaucoma, herpes-type infection
of the eye, infection, recent nasal surgery or existing nasal sores, liver disease, tuberculosis, underactive thyroid,
allergies to corticosteroids. Though very unlikely, it is possible Nasacort AQ will be absorbed into your bloodstream.
This may have undesirable consequences that may require additional corticosteroid treatment. This is especially true for
children and for those who have used this for an extended period if they also have serious medical problems such as
serious infections, injuries or surgeries. This precaution applies for up to one year after stopping use of Nasacort AQ.
Consult your doctor or pharmacist for more details. Caution is advised in children as Nasacort AQ may affect growth patterns.
Consult child's doctor. Nasacort AQ should be used only when clearly needed during pregnancy. Discuss the risks and
benefits with your doctor. It is unknown if this form of triamcinolone is excreted into breast milk. Other dosage forms
of triamcinolone are excreted into breast milk. Consult your doctor before breast-feeding. DRUG INTERACTIONS:

NOTES: If no improvement in your symptoms is noted after 3 weeks
of using Nasacort AQ, notify your doctor. Another medication may be needed or the dose may need adjusting. Inform all your
doctors you use, or have used, Nasacort AQ. Watering or itching eyes often associated with allergies are not significantly
relieved by Nasacort AQ. Each canister contains approximately 100-120 sprays.
MISSED DOSE:
If you miss a dose, use it as soon as remembered; do not use if it is almost time for the next dose, instead,
skip the missed dose and resume your usual dosing schedule. Do not "double-up" the dose to catch up.
Store Nasacort AQ at room temperature between 36 and 77 degrees F (2 -25
degrees C) away from light and moisture. Avoid freezing.
